So, 'And Then the Grave' is this eerie little horror flick from 2024 that really digs into psychological terror. The whole vibe is claustrophobic, and it’s shot in this stark, minimalistic room which amps up the tension. You’ve got this guy waking up with a masked stranger, and it feels like a twisted game of cat and mouse. The pacing is relentless, slowly peeling back layers of the protagonist's dark past. What’s striking is how it tackles themes of guilt and inevitability—there’s just no way out for him. The practical effects are solid and add to the grim atmosphere. Performances are raw, really conveying the struggle. It’s distinctive in its approach to horror, focusing more on the mind than jump scares.
